  2. ok called 1-800 and asked for status of my claim got e-mail response today. As follows. We have received communication from the Cleveland Regional Office. They have stated that after your claim for dependency was completed (see notification letter dated February 1, 2011) your claim file was inadvertently returned to the files, instead of leaving it open to complete your claim for increase dated May 11, 2010. We greatly apologize for our error and any inconvenience this may have caused. The Veteran’s Service Representative (VSR) working your claim will immediately pull your file. If all evidence and documentation in support of your claim has been received, the VSR will make your claim ready for a decision. If more evidence is needed, the VSR will contact you in this regard. So here we go again. Rule number #1 folks do not open more then one claim at a time it just confuses them.
